Output 59685520a6d598f86c340441710d1c34f46bc41e6a860a38fbd83f93052e12b4:15

value
1604479
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0aaf20ced42476da55b8ec4d6110de444aa7aaa4 OP_EQUALVERIFY OP_CHECKSIG
address
1yVZ35mo1QoCJauD87enBTveGrcvQc5bq
transaction
59685520a6d598f86c340441710d1c34f46bc41e6a860a38fbd83f93052e12b4
spent
true